Part of the endomembrane system in the cytoplasm , the Golgi apparatus packages proteins into membrane - bound vesicles inside the cell before the vesicles are sent to their destination . The Golgi apparatus resides at the intersection of the secretory , lysosomal , and endocytic pathways . It is of particular importance in processing proteins for secretion , containing a set of glycosylation enzymes that attach various sugar monomers to proteins as the proteins move through the apparatus .

Diamonds are far from evenly distributed over the Earth . A rule of thumb known as Clifford 's rule states that they are almost always found in kimberlites on the oldest part of cratons , the stable cores of continents with typical ages of 2.5 billion years or more . However , there are exceptions . The Argyle diamond mine in Australia , the largest producer of diamonds by weight in the world , is located in a mobile belt , also known as an orogenic belt , a weaker zone surrounding the central craton that has undergone compressional tectonics . Instead of kimberlite , the host rock is lamproite . Lamproites with diamonds that are not economically viable are also found in the United States , India and Australia . In addition , diamonds in the Wawa belt of the Superior province in Canada and microdiamonds in the island arc of Japan are found in a type of rock called lamprophyre .

The United States is one of the five recognized nuclear powers by the signatories of the Treaty on the Non-Proliferation of Nuclear Weapons ( NPT ) . As of 2017 , the US has an estimated 4,018 nuclear weapons in either deployment or storage . This figure compares to a peak of 31,225 total warheads in 1967 and 22,217 in 1989 , and does not include `` several thousand '' warheads that have been retired and scheduled for dismantlement . The Pantex Plant near Amarillo , Texas , is the only location in the United States where weapons from the aging nuclear arsenal can be refurbished or dismantled .

The Epic of Gilgamesh ( / ˈɡɪlɡəˌmɛʃ / ) is an epic poem from ancient Mesopotamia that is often regarded as the earliest surviving great work of literature . The literary history of Gilgamesh begins with five Sumerian poems about Bilgamesh ( Sumerian for `` Gilgamesh '' ) , king of Uruk , dating from the Third Dynasty of Ur ( c. 2100 BC ) . These independent stories were later used as source material for a combined epic . The first surviving version of this combined epic , known as the `` Old Babylonian '' version , dates to the 18th century BC and is titled after its incipit , Shūtur eli sharrī ( `` Surpassing All Other Kings '' ) . Only a few tablets of it have survived . The later `` standard '' version dates from the 13th to the 10th centuries BC and bears the incipit Sha naqba īmuru ( `` He who Saw the Deep '' , in modern terms : `` He who Sees the Unknown '' ) . Approximately two thirds of this longer , twelve - tablet version have been recovered . Some of the best copies were discovered in the library ruins of the 7th - century BC Assyrian king Ashurbanipal .

Before the 1984 Winter Olympics , a dispute formed over what made a player a professional . The IOC had adopted a rule that made any player who had signed an NHL contract but played less than ten games in the league eligible . However , the United States Olympic Committee maintained that any player contracted with an NHL team was a professional and therefore not eligible to play . The IOC held an emergency meeting that ruled NHL - contracted players were eligible , as long as they had not played in any NHL games . This made five players on Olympic rosters -- one Austrian , two Italians and two Canadians -- ineligible . Players who had played in other professional leagues -- such as the World Hockey Association -- were allowed to play . Canadian hockey official Alan Eagleson stated that the rule was only applied to the NHL and that professionally contracted players in European leagues were still considered amateurs . Murray Costello of the CAHA suggested that a Canadian withdrawal was possible . In 1986 , the IOC voted to allow all athletes to compete in Olympic Games starting in 1988 , but let the individual sport federations decide if they wanted to allow professionals .

A transatlantic telegraph cable is an undersea cable running under the Atlantic Ocean used for telegraph communications . The first was laid across the floor of the Atlantic from Telegraph Field , Foilhommerum Bay , Valentia Island in western Ireland to Heart 's Content in eastern Newfoundland . The first communications occurred August 16 , 1858 , reducing the communication time between North America and Europe from ten days -- the time it took to deliver a message by ship -- to only 17 hours . Transatlantic telegraph cables have been replaced by transatlantic telecommunications cables .

The flatworms , flat worms , Platyhelminthes , Plathelminthes , or platyhelminths ( from the Greek πλατύ , platy , meaning `` flat '' and ἕλμινς ( root : ἑλμινθ - ) , helminth - , meaning `` worm '' ) are a phylum of relatively simple bilaterian , unsegmented , soft - bodied invertebrates . Unlike other bilaterians , they are acoelomates ( having no body cavity ) , and have no specialized circulatory and respiratory organs , which restricts them to having flattened shapes that allow oxygen and nutrients to pass through their bodies by diffusion . The digestive cavity has only one opening for both ingestion ( intake of nutrients ) and egestion ( removal of undigested wastes ) ; as a result , the food can not be processed continuously .

John Williams composed the film 's score , which earned him an Academy Award , his second win and first for Original Score , and was later ranked the sixth greatest score by the American Film Institute . The main `` shark '' theme , a simple alternating pattern of two notes -- variously identified as `` E and F '' or `` F and F sharp '' -- became a classic piece of suspense music , synonymous with approaching danger ( see leading - tone ) . Williams described the theme as `` grinding away at you , just as a shark would do , instinctual , relentless , unstoppable . '' The piece was performed by tuba player Tommy Johnson . When asked by Johnson why the melody was written in such a high register and not played by the more appropriate French horn , Williams responded that he wanted it to sound `` a little more threatening '' . When Williams first demonstrated his idea to Spielberg , playing just the two notes on a piano , Spielberg was said to have laughed , thinking that it was a joke . As Williams saw similarities between Jaws and pirate movies , at other points in the score he evoked `` pirate music '' , which he called `` primal , but fun and entertaining ''. The primal opening notes are developed from the opening foreboding tone of Ravel 's La Valse . Calling for rapid , percussive string playing , the score contains echoes of La mer by Claude Debussy as well of Igor Stravinsky 's The Rite of Spring .

The wet feet , dry feet policy or wet foot , dry foot policy is the name given to a former interpretation of the 1995 revision of the application of the Cuban Adjustment Act of 1966 that essentially says that anyone who fled Cuba and entered the United States would be allowed to pursue residency a year later . Prior to 1995 , the US government allowed all Cubans who reached US territorial waters to remain in the US . After talks with the Cuban government , the Clinton administration came to an agreement with Cuba that it would stop admitting people intercepted in U.S. waters . For several decades thereafter , in what became known as the `` Wet foot , Dry foot '' policy , a Cuban caught on the waters between the two nations ( with `` wet feet '' ) would summarily be sent home or to a third country . One who makes it to shore ( `` dry feet '' ) gets a chance to remain in the United States , and later would qualify for expedited `` legal permanent resident '' status in accordance with the 1966 Act and eventually U.S. citizenship . In January 2017 , the Obama administration announced the immediate end of the policy shortly before President Barack Obama 's term expired .

French Baroque architecture , sometimes called French classicism , was a style of architecture during the reigns of Louis XIII ( 1610 -- 43 ) , Louis XIV ( 1643 -- 1715 ) and Louis XV ( 1715 -- 74 ) . It was preceded by the French Renaissance and Mannerism styles , and was followed in the second half of the 18th century by Neo-classicism . The style was originally inspired by the Italian Baroque style , but , particularly under Louis XIV , it gave greater emphasis to regularity , the colossal order of facades , and the use of colonnades and cupolas , to symbolize the power and grandeur of the King . Notable examples of the style include the Grand Trianon of the Palace of Versailles , and the dome of Les Invalides in Paris . In the final years of Louis XIV and the reign of Louis XV , the style became lighter , colossal orders gradually disappeared and the style became lighter , and saw the introduction of wrought iron decoration in rocaille designs . The period also saw the introduction of monumental urban squares in Paris and other cities , notably Place Vendôme and the Place de la Concorde . The style profoundly influenced 18th - century secular architecture throughout Europe ; the Palace of Versailles and the French formal garden were copied by other courts all over Europe .

Unlike most Western countries , half of the US states do not have a legal minimum age of marriage . While in most US states , individuals age 18 have the ability to marry ( with two exceptions -- Nebraska ( 19 ) and Mississippi ( 21 ) ) , all states allow minors to marry in certain circumstances , such as parental consent , judicial consent , pregnancy , or a combination of these situations . Most states allow parties aged 16 and 17 to marry with parental consent alone . In most states , children under 16 can be married too . In the 25 states which have an absolute minimum age set by statute , this age varies between 13 and 17 , while in 25 states there is no statutory minimum age if other legal conditions are met . Although in such states there is no set minimum age by statute , the traditional common law minimum age is 14 for boys and 12 for girls - ages which have been confirmed by case law in some states . Over the past 15 years , more than 200,000 minors married in US , and in Tennessee girls as young as 10 were married in 2001 .

Empedocles established four ultimate elements which make all the structures in the world -- fire , air , water , earth -- in other words , the several states of matter are represented , being energies , gasses , liquids , and solids . Empedocles called these four elements `` roots '' , which he also identified with the mythical names of Zeus , Hera , Nestis , and Aidoneus ( e.g. , `` Now hear the fourfold roots of everything : enlivening Hera , Hades , shining Zeus . And Nestis , moistening mortal springs with tears . '' ) Empedocles never used the term `` element '' ( Greek : στοιχεῖον , stoicheion ) , which seems to have been first used by Plato . According to the different proportions in which these four indestructible and unchangeable elements are combined with each other the difference of the structure is produced . It is in the aggregation and segregation of elements thus arising , that Empedocles , like the atomists , found the real process which corresponds to what is popularly termed growth , increase or decrease . Nothing new comes or can come into being ; the only change that can occur is a change in the juxtaposition of element with element . This theory of the four elements became the standard dogma for the next two thousand years .
